US Data Update: 2020 Democratic Party Platform

30 Aug 2020

The Democratic Party's platform has been updated! The Democratic Party's convention took place August 17-20, and was largely a virtual event. The party platform was released in time for the convention.

The Republican Party's convention took place the following week, August 24-27. Breaking with tradition, the party did not issue a programmatic platform for the 2020 election. Instead, the party voted to forgo a 2020 platform, choosing instead to focus on presidential re-election.
